THE STRUGGLING Australian insurer AMP is to close its UK life insurer NPI to new business, writes the Telegraph. The move marks a capitulation by AMP in its attempt to sell NPI and several other businesses after announcing last month plans to demerge its UK operations as a separate company called Henderson. This new business would include fund manager Henderson, and UK life insurance businesses Pearl, NPI and London Life as well as IFA Towry Law, Ample, the internet portal, and half of Virgin Direct.
